# Break-Glass: Catalog Cache Invalidation

Scope: the Pinrow product catalog at Veldstone Retail. If stale prices persist after a purge and the Hollowmere invalidation queue is wedged, use break-glass to flush the edge tier directly. Contractors: get verbal sign-off from the catalog lead first. Steps: open the Hollowmere admin shell, select emergency-flush, confirm the tenant, and run it once — repeated flushes thrash the origin. Access is logged and expires after 20 minutes. Unseal the admin shell with the passphrase below.

recovery phrase for kahop-tajog: istix-casvan

Subject: On-call heads-up — Orchardly catalog cache. Welcome aboard. The main gotcha: catalog price updates invalidate by SKU, but bundle pages cache composite keys, so a stale bundle can outlive its parts. If support reports wrong bundle prices, purge the composite namespace first. We'll cover this at the weekly sync; the invalidation playbook is on this internal page.

wiki page, yagef-tawif: https://sentry.lumicdata.local/view/merge_requests/pipeline/merge_requests/e08f7f35c80b5755

## Ticket: Config drift in Ledgerlens audit-log viewer

Plugin authors have reported that the Ledgerlens audit-log viewer behaves differently across tenants; investigation confirms the retention and redaction settings drifted from the documented defaults. Plugins should not compensate for this in code. Until remediation completes, treat the following as the canonical configuration.

deployment values, yadug-bawif:
[framir]
team = pelox
access_code = ac_a38ab2
owner = tamion.julael
host = framir.tolvaqlabs.test
port = 11211
peer = tammir.zemvargrid.local
salt = 2215ef03
pin = 1541

Subject: Firmware channel cut-over — summary for new joiners

Hi all,

Welcome aboard. Last week we completed the cut-over of the Larkbeam device fleet from the legacy "seasonal" firmware channel to the new staged rollout channel. Updates now flow through three rings — canary, early, and broad — with automatic rollback on health-check failure. All devices checked in successfully post-migration. The channel service configuration now in effect is shown below.

config for tawif-bagef:
[sorwyn]
team = sorys
access_code = ac_9ba40c
host = sorwyn.ordingrid.local
port = 5000
owner = aldok.quenion
peer = belath.paliqcloud.local